Mosa Restaurant And Bar
3979 Buford Hwy Ne, 30345-1681 - Atlanta
Verified Dish
Add Missing Dish
Contact Information
📞
Phone:
+1 404-254-2280
🌐 Website:
https://www.mosarestaurantbar.com/
📍
Address:
3979 Buford Hwy Ne, Atlanta
